WebThe Specialist Weapons School’s (SWS) mission is to train the required number of Officers and Soldiers to the appropriate standard, in order to support the operational requirements … Web24 Jan 2024 · The second weapon carried by a sniper is an SA80, another primary weapon system used by all snipers. It is designed for anti-ambush drills and small-range combat. The sharpshooter rifle is another long-range weapon, used by Sniper No.2, also referred to as the 'spotter'. It is a 7.62mm calibre rifle and is accurate from 600 metres to 900 metres.

Chuck Mawhinney (103 Kills) Charles Benjamin “Chuck” Mawhinney was a former United States Marine who served 16 months in the military during the Vietnam War. As a sniper, Mawhinney is credited with having 103 confirmed kills (a Marine Corps record), with 216 probable kills. The first U.S. Army Sniper School was initiated in 1955, right after the Korean War cease-fire. The present U.S. Army Sniper School was established at Fort Benning, Georgia, in 1987. The length of the school is for five weeks. how to do a derivative in excel
